Understanding Toxic Dynamics

  • 💡 Social rejection or criticism triggers a biological defense mechanism, activating brain regions associated with physical pain.
  • 🎯 Toxic people thrive on reaction, feeding on frustration and escalating when engaged emotionally.
  • 🔑 The smartest strategy is to interrupt the automatic response to break this cycle.

Mastering Your Response

  • 🧠 Utilize the power of the pause—a few seconds between stimulus and response—to shift from emotional reaction to rational choice.
  • ✅ Respond with calm control instead of anger or over-explaining, as this removes the payoff for toxic behavior.
  • 🚀 Remember you don't have to attend every argument; observe patterns and choose not to engage in predictable provocations.

Establishing Clear Boundaries

  • ⚠️ Setting boundaries is crucial because what gets tolerated gets repeated, and toxic people pay attention to what you allow.
  • 💬 Practice assertive communication by clearly stating what you will and will not participate in, without lengthy explanations or apologies.
  • 🌱 While initially uncomfortable, boundaries improve healthy relationships by fostering clarity and respect, and help you avoid resentment.

Building Inner Resilience

  • 💡 Strengthen your inner voice and self-concept clarity to become less affected by external criticism and social rejection.
  • 🔍 Learn to evaluate criticism ("Is there truth here?") rather than absorbing it, which allows for growth without internalizing negativity.
  • ✨ Practice self-affirmation and self-validation by reflecting on your core values and qualities, building internal strength against projections from others.
